Area contextNeighborhood Overview – Wheeler Transitional and Developmental Center (Irving, TX)
The Wheeler Transitional and Developmental Center is situated in the vibrant city of Irving, Texas, a key part of the Dallas-Fort Worth Metroplex. Located at 1600 E Shady Grove Road, the center benefits from its position within a well-connected urban area. Major thoroughfares like State Highway 183 (Airport Freeway) and Interstate 35E are easily accessible, facilitating straightforward travel from various parts of the DFW region. For those arriving by air, Dallas/Fort Worth International Airport (DFW) is approximately a 10-15 minute drive away, while Dallas Love Field (DAL) is about a 20-25 minute drive. Public transportation options, including Dallas Area Rapid Transit (DART) bus routes, serve the vicinity, though private vehicle or rideshare services are generally more convenient for reaching the center directly. Smart arrival tactics involve factoring in potential traffic, especially during peak commute hours on weekdays, and allowing extra time for parking and check-in procedures.

Weather & Seasons at Wheeler Transitional and Developmental Center
- Winter: Winter in Irving typically brings cool temperatures, with daytime highs often in the 50s and overnight lows dipping into the 30s. It's advisable to pack layers, including sweaters, jackets, and perhaps a lighter coat. While snow is infrequent, occasional freezing rain or cold snaps can occur, so checking the forecast before your visit is wise.
- Spring & early summer: Spring offers warm and pleasant weather, with temperatures gradually increasing from the 70s into the 80s. This is an excellent time for outdoor activities, though brief, heavy rain showers are common. Light jackets or long-sleeved shirts are useful for cooler mornings and evenings, while short sleeves are fine for most days.
- Mid-summer: Mid-summer is characterized by significant heat and humidity. Daytime temperatures frequently exceed 90 degrees Fahrenheit and can reach into the triple digits. Light, breathable clothing such as cotton or linen is recommended. Staying hydrated and planning any outdoor activities for early morning or late evening is crucial.
- Fall season: Fall provides a welcome transition to cooler, more comfortable weather, with temperatures ranging from the 70s in early fall down to the 50s by late season. This period is ideal for exploring the area. Long sleeves, light sweaters, and perhaps a medium-weight jacket are practical for this time of year.
- Rain & snow: Rainfall is possible year-round, but it tends to be more frequent in the spring and fall. During winter, precipitation can sometimes fall as sleet or light snow, though significant accumulations are rare. Bringing an umbrella or waterproof jacket is always a good idea, and sturdy, closed-toe shoes are practical for any weather conditions.
